It means having a shared goal and designing a process to help the group meet that goal. Facilitation is also defined by its approach to process and content: a facilitative approach means designing a process which supports a group in discovering, ideating and creating their own content.

A survey was distributed to 75 employees in a New Zealand organisation. Fifty-eight (77%) returned usable data. Levels of work-family and family-work facilitation and conflict were not related to gender, age or number of dependents. With regard to marital status, non-partnered respondents reported higher levels of WFF than partnered respondents.১৫ জুন, ২০১৫ ... Neural facilitation. Neural facilitation, also known as paired-pulse facilitation ( PPF ), is a phenomenon in neuroscience in which postsynaptic potentials (PSPs) ( EPPs, EPSPs or IPSPs) evoked by an impulse are increased when that impulse closely follows a prior impulse. PPF is thus a form of short-term synaptic plasticity.

The concept was first proposed by Norman Triplett in 1898; psychologist Floyd Allport labeled it social facilitation in 1920. Whether or not social facilitation occurs depends on the type of task: people tend to experience social ... One of the most challenging parts of facilitating UX workshops is managing the various personalities and perspectives in the room: encouraging full participation, helping naturally reserved people contribute, and redirecting overly dominant participants towards shared goals.
